Bill Summary: HB 5545 (PA 10-3)
-
Reduces appropriations to state agencies totaling $77.6 million for FY 2010 and $120.7 million for FY 2011 across equipment, personal services, and program funding
-
Implements Medicaid cost-sharing changes including copayment requirements aligned with state employee plans and limits premium assistance eligibility to those enrolled in Charter Oak Health Plan as of April 30, 2010
-
Establishes new revenue sources by transferring $5 million from Tobacco and Health Trust Fund, $3.5 million from Biomedical Research Fund, $10 million from Citizens' Election Fund, and $15 million from Banking Fund to the General Fund
-
Increases hunting, fishing, and trapping license fees by reducing them below previous amounts and establishes new permit requirements; reduces camping and state park fees for residents by capping increases at 135% of April 2009 rates
-
Authorizes state parks to establish special event rental fees and creates a separate maintenance and improvement account for state park revenues, with $1 million transferred from Conservation Fund for FY 2010
